## Runbook: LedgerLens Audit-Log Viewer — Release Verification

Before promoting a LedgerLens build, confirm the viewer can read the sealed audit partitions in the Quorville staging cluster. Run the parity check against the prior release and verify that no log entries are dropped during pagination. If the parity check passes, record the build hash in the release ledger and proceed. The viewer authenticates to the internal attestation service with the key below.

service key, bajep-hahig: zpat15_8GdlyV2kd9BCqYH

Ticket: Staging env misconfigured for Siftgate bloom filter

The bloom layer in front of the Pellet KV store is rejecting all lookups in staging because the env file was copied from the dev template without credentials. False-positive tuning values are fine; only the auth line is missing. To unblock the weekly demo, the Pellet admission secret must be set on the following line.

env line for yaguf-fajop: LEDGER_TOKEN13=fb08984397349

### CI Note: Fan-out Backpressure — Pillbrook Notify

If the notify stage stalls, the fan-out queue is saturating; workers apply backpressure above 10k pending. Don't restart the runner — drain via the throttle flag instead. Retries after a forced restart duplicate sends. Confirm you're on the patched pipeline by checking the trace token directly below.

trace token, tawep-fahif: htk3_b58